Thailand Reclaims Sky: Direct Flights to the US Poised for Takeoff

Thailand is soaring to new heights with plans to reconnect with the United States through direct flight routes, a move that promises to cement its position as Southeast Asia’s premier aviation hub. The news comes as part of the government’s ambitious agenda, spearheaded by Transport Minister Suriya Jungrungreangkit, to bolster Thailand’s global presence. These non-stop flights, poised to bridge the gap between Thailand and the US, could substantially elevate the kingdom’s status on the international stage. In a surprising twist, at present, no airline offers a direct connection between these two countries, even though the demand is palpable. Thai Airways once graced the skies with routes to Los Angeles and New York, yet these were grounded in 2015 after the US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) clipped Thailand’s wings by downgrading its aviation safety rating to Category 2.
